What you get
| Tier | Limit (per key, per minute) | What changes for you |
|---|---|---|
| Anonymous (default) | 30 | Bucketed per source IP. Multiple agents behind one IP share the budget. |
| Sponsor (any tier ≥ $5/mo) | 300 | Bucketed per API key. Same headroom regardless of source IP; multiple machines can share one key. |
The tier doesn't unlock any extra tools — it's the same 19-tool surface for anonymous users and sponsors. What changes is the rate limit and the bucketing scope.

Security model
- The raw API key never leaves your client config and the Cloudflare Worker's request scope. The Worker only stores the SHA-256 hash of the key in KV; if the KV ever leaked, no usable keys would leak with it.
- Keys are revokable. If you suspect yours leaked, email the maintainer (any GitHub Sponsors DM works) — the old key gets removed and a new one issued in the same step.
- Anonymous traffic and sponsor traffic share the same compute path. There's no preferential routing or extra data exposed to sponsors. The only difference at runtime is the rate-limit bucket the request lands in.
- The Worker logs the SHA-256 of any presented key alongside the per-request structured log entry (so a misbehaving client can be pinpointed without knowing the raw key). Logs are dropped after Cloudflare's default retention.
